The original Fiesta dessert bowl was initially thought of as the Fiesta fruit bowl by its maker, designer Frederick Rhead. The outside rings were formed by the mold while the inside was then hand jiggered which we see in the inside ring variation, pattern and depth. A popular bowl, produced for the entire length of the original Fiestaware line and found in all eleven vintage colors, and exceedingly rare in medium green.

Vintage Fiesta Salt and Pepper Shakers
in Original Medium Green Glaze »

Circa 1959-1969: The fiesta salt and pepper shakers make up two of the 14 pieces that were made through the entire vintage production. They were part of the original line and oddly enough were sold seperately and not as pairs although there is a distint difference in them, the pepper having smaller holes and a smaller hole pattern than the salts. Due to their small size they were also one of the very few Fiesta items that were not marked. VIntage Fiesta Salt & Pepper Shakers
in Original Green Glaze »

Circa 1937-1951: The fiesta salt and pepper shakers make up two of the 14 pieces that were made through the entire vintage production. They were part of the original line and oddly enough were sold seperately and not as pairs although there is a distint difference in them, the pepper having smaller holes and a smaller hole pattern than the salts. Due to their small size they were also one of the very few Fiesta items that were not marked. Slip cast, the mold seam would have to be smoothed by hand, as in many of the slipcast items, but probably because of their small size, the seams tend to show up more on the Fiesta shaker than most pieces.
